Hi everyone! It's been a while since I posted but I'm back now. To update anyone that might be interested.....I had my lap band surgery 2 years ago as of April 29th and to date, I've lost 231 pounds! I still have about 75 pounds to go, but there's no doubt in my mind, I'll do it. My band has been a miracle band as I've only had 3 fills in 2 years. So any one that says you can't lose that much weight with the lap band, that's a load of bull! I feel like a different person and quite frankly look like one, too. My band literally saved my life and I'll be forever grateful to everyone on here that has given me nothing but support. Hope everyone is doing well and I hope to talk to some of y'all soon. Becky

Hi ya'll. I reached the grand milestone of -100 lbs. last week. I had my surgery on September 5 of last year, so I'm just 8 months out. I'm 6 lbs. from my initial goal (may re-evaluate at that point), and couldn't be happier. I'm down from a size 26W jeans to size 12. I am off of 3 blood pressure-related prescription meds. My plantar fasciitis is completely gone. Knee pain gone. My flexibility, stamina, and strength are up, up, up.
